Transaction 90847623b33a35121bb60f591b9a0d7b13ea75c3ec603e46a4c109f44e4568d7

2 Input
2 Outputs
  • 90847623b33a35121bb60f591b9a0d7b13ea75c3ec603e46a4c109f44e4568d7:0
  • value  33879
    address  1PB6VCXwcH36Enjsj1pPKxrDretNeHuj5R
  • 90847623b33a35121bb60f591b9a0d7b13ea75c3ec603e46a4c109f44e4568d7:1
  • value  7115476
    address  1Mq4KgraQgibmvhky82e7YqXwyhjqMr9Bh